What is the Foreign National DSCR Loan?
The Foreign National DSCR Loan is a specialized mortgage product designed for foreign nationals who wish to invest in U.S. real estate. Unlike traditional loans, which require personal income documentation, credit history, and tax returns, the DSCR Loan focuses solely on the property’s financial performance.
DSCR stands for Debt Service Coverage Ratio, a metric that compares a property’s net operating income (NOI) to its debt obligations (mortgage payments). If a property’s rental income or other revenue can cover the debt service, investors can qualify for the loan. For foreign nationals, this means that the qualification proCESs is centered around the property’s income, not the investor’s personal financial situation.
How Does the Foreign National DSCR Loan Work?
The Foreign National DSCR Loan program evaluates the property’s ability to generate income that can cover its mortgage payments. The process is straightforward and relies primarily on the property’s cash flow, making it much easier for foreign investors to qualify.
Foreign nationals do not need to provide U.S. tax returns, personal income documentation, or a U.S. credit score. Instead, the lender assesses the property’s Debt Service Coverage Ratio (DSCR). If the property generates enough cash flow to cover the loan’s debt obligations, the loan is approved.
For example, if an investor purchases a rental property in the U.S., the rental income from the property will be considered the primary source of income for the loan qualification process. As long as the income generated by the property can cover the debt service, the investor can secure financing regardless of their personal financial situation.
